When I started doing this line I discovered Dina was usually born Adéline but carried the name Délima & Dina.

Gilberte

I never found any proof to say who the parents of Tharsile Charron were.

I tried to find her baptism at Notre Dame of Ottawa, St Stephen in Chelsea, Lac Baskakong, Maniwaki's L'Assomption, Aylmer Mission recoreds at St Paul Church now burnt to the ground.

I figured her to be Charron dit Wabinikik from a Reserve in Quebec. I wrote to Maniwaki several times to ask what comment was in the margin for that family and even got the film via inter library loan. . . it mentioned the family of Michel Ethier & Tharsile Charron & who they married ONLY.

Since no one claimed Tharsile Charron I figured she must be Amerindienne.

My father now passed some ten years ago remembered his grandmother Angéline Ethier as being NATIVE. She lived on Maniwaki Reserve most of her life but died at her son's place at Lac Bitobi her first husband was a Marchand & second husband was Benjamin Chalifoux.

Ben Chalifoux was a sub chief and signed Land surrenders in 1890-1891 & he appears in books as Jolifou in Treaty Books.
